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 002 Hazard: FALLING
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970: The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to the hazard of falling from a suspended load: a) Choptank River Bridge, Newport News Floating Rig - Employees exposed to a fall of 48" while riding the load (15" wide steel beam) on 10/2/85. Among other methods, one feasible and acceptable abatement method to correct this hazard is the use of personnel hoising equipment that complies with OSHA standards.
